Package: installation-reports Severity: normal hybrid squeeze iso when dd'ed to a usb results in an installer which installs grub to the 'wrong device'. The installer will try to install grub2 to /dev/sda, but that is my usb drive! (and thus the wrong 'device'). -- System Information: Debian Release: 6.0 APT prefers testing APT policy: (500, 'testing'), (500, 'stable') Architecture: amd64 (x86_64) Kernel: Linux 2.6.37 (SMP w/4 CPU cores) Locale: LANG=en_AU.UTF-8, LC_CTYPE=en_AU.UTF-8 (charmap=UTF-8) Shell: /bin/sh linked to /bin/bash
